Association of dietary phosphorus intake and phosphorus to protein ratio with mortality in hemodialysis patients

N Noori, K Kalantar-Zadeh, CP Kovesdy… - Clinical Journal of the …, 2010 - journals.lww.com
Background and objectives: Epidemiologic studies show an association between higher
predialysis serum phosphorus and increased death risk in maintenance hemodialysis
(MHD) patients. The hypothesis that higher dietary phosphorus intake and higher
phosphorus content per gram of dietary protein intake are each associated with increased
mortality in MHD patients was examined.
